We are working on an exclusive basis with a number of schools in Brent & Harrow that are looking to build a localised pool of qualified Secondary Supply Teachers to form "bubbles" who can satisfy the supply needs across all subjects for this academic year. The Schools have well thought out, consistent and reliable practice in place to ensure staff and student safety being mindful that they still need to respect distancing, exposure and safety standards. As such we have agreements with a number of schools to provide small bubble groups of supply staff, who will attend a limited number of schools to try and limit the risk of Covid transmission. Being assigned to a small number of schools on this basis will still facilitate up to a maximum 5 working days per week (although we also encourage applications for those who desire less).
